*On a side note I would like a good aftermarket / cheap cup holder alternative for the front with bench seat if anyone has a good one. Like to have my babeses squeeze up beside me but my door is already full of wet wipes and a lil garbage basket.

Not sure if it will help, but I put a storage bin on the floor hump.

http://www.walmart.ca/en/ip/gogear-seat-console/6000162309056

Fits perfect and gives me 2 more cupholders (for cups that won't leak if they fall over). Of course she won't be able to put her feet on the floor when squeezed over.
